- Chao Yng Che'eng
- (d. 1657)Chinese civil servant. He was born in Kaifeng. He entered public service as a mandarin and served at Fukien (1650-3), and in Hukwang (1656-7). He was largely respon-sible for rebuilding the Kaifeng synagogue in 1653. Although he was regarded as a Confucian mandarin when in Fukien, he lived as a religious Jew when in Honan, his home province.
